Why choose our application maintenance company
-
20+ years in software services
With over two decades of experience in software development and application support services, Binary Studio has helped numerous businesses achieve long-term market success, ensuring cost efficiency and smooth product updates.
-
Top 0.5% of engineers
Each of our developers and testers passes a rigorous technical assessment and has opportunities for continuous training to stay current with the latest technologies. You can rest assured that your application will get the best care.
-
Flexible application maintenance services
As every software product is unique and every business has its goals and processes, we always remain flexible to adapt to your needs, timeline, team structure, and other nuances. We can extend your internal team or build a dedicated support team to handle your app.
-
User-centric maintenance strategy
We continuously incorporate user feedback into making improvements to the application. After all, it’s the end users who define the success of your application, and the maintenance strategy should put their concerns in the center.
-
Proactive approach
With our application support and maintenance services, you get a team of professionals who don’t simply react to problems but continuously monitor your application from all possible angles to detect problems as quickly as possible and fix them in the most efficient manner.
-
Experience in different industries
Binary Studio has built development, testing, and maintenance teams for projects that range from healthcare to entertainment and from fintech to green construction services. We work with virtually any technology and any type of app.
Our application maintenance services
-
All levels of app support services
We can help you take care of all the app support tiers, from L0, the creation of guiding materials and knowledge bases that reduce issues, to L1-3, identifying and fixing various issues related to navigating the app.
-
Mobile app maintenance services
We provide platform-specific maintenance for iOS and Android applications, including compatibility updates, compliance with app store rules, performance optimization, and feature enhancements.
-
Web application maintenance services
If you have a web-based app, we can handle its browser compatibility, security updates, performance optimization, server maintenance, and database management, ensuring that the product remains easy to use, fast, and secure across all intended devices.
-
App compliance management
If your application is designed for regulated domains, we can help you stay compliant with industry regulations and standards such as GDPR, HIPAA, PCI-DSS, or others, regardless of the region.
-
App security management
We implement layered security measures and conduct regular security audits to ensure that your web or mobile application remains safe under different circumstances and is continuously protected from possible threats.
-
Dedicated app support team
We can build a dedicated team that will work exclusively on your application support and maintenance, offering you lightning-fast issue resolution, consistency, and proactive recommendations for improvements.
The breakdown of application support services
The process of app support and maintenance will depend on your particular needs. Here are the major steps that we follow when offering such services:
- 01
Gathering requirements
⠀ 1-2 weeks
We begin with a comprehensive assessment of your current application to understand maintenance challenges, technologies involved, and your business goals.
- 02
The set-up of app maintenance services
⠀ 1-2 weeks
After analyzing your app’s architecture, we’ll configure support and maintenance tools, set up metrics, and begin the monitoring process.
- 03
Ongoing support and maintenance
⠀ Project lifetime
We’ll take care of your app, monitoring its performance, identifying and fixing issues, rolling out updates, and handling user requests if needed.
- 04
Reporting and improvements
⠀ Project lifetime
An important thing you should expect from an application support company is regular reviews to make sure that the maintenance strategy and support services work as required.
Binary Studio’s awards
We’re proud to be recognized as industry leaders in many categories. For instance, the B2B platform Clutch has been featuring us among the best software testing companies and consumer app developers.
Our app maintenance cases
As a development provider and web and mobile app maintenance company, we’ve handled hundreds of different products and helped businesses effortlessly scale and improve their solutions.
What our clients say
Our app maintenance tech stacl
Frontend
- HTML
- CSS
- JavaScript
- Vue
- React
- Angular
- Electron
Mobile
QA
- Cypress
- Selenium
- Chai
- Playwright
- Puppeteer
- Mocha
- Jasmine
Database
- SQL Server
- MySQL
- PostgreSQL
- SQLite
- MongoDB
- Amazon RDS
- Google Cloud SQL
Frameworks
- Express.js
- Fastify
- Laravel
- Symfony
- CakePHP
- Redux
- ASP.NET
- Flask
Stack
-
HTML
-
CSS
-
JavaScript
-
Vue
-
React
-
Angular
-
Electron
-
Cypress
-
Selenium
-
Chai
-
Playwright
-
Puppeteer
-
Mocha
-
Jasmine
-
SQL Server
-
MySQL
-
PostgreSQL
-
SQLite
-
MongoDB
-
Amazon RDS
-
Google Cloud SQL
-
Express.js
-
Fastify
-
Laravel
-
Symfony
-
CakePHP
-
Redux
-
ASP.NET
-
Flask
FAQ
-
Why do I need application maintenance services?
Modern applications require continuous attention to remain secure, perform smoothly, and align with user expectations. Without proper maintenance, applications become vulnerable to security threats and might deteriorate in quality. With IT application support services, you can achieve the following benefits:
- Fast bug fixes. Continuous maintenance allows engineers to react to issues before they start affecting the user experience.
- No outdated features. Regular updates keep your application current with user expectations and industry standards
- Faster updates. Thanks to streamlined maintenance processes, you can get a faster deployment of app updates.
- Enhanced security. As threats and vulnerabilities evolve, continuous maintenance can help you protect your application.
- Satisfied users. With consistent performance, reliability, and adherence to the latest usability standards, you can maintain positive user experiences with your application and reach new levels of loyalty.
- Improved scalability. Ongoing optimization ensures your application can handle growing user demands.
- Easier performance monitoring. With a comprehensive monitoring strategy in place, you can get insights into the application’s performance and user behavior, which can be important for planning further releases.
- Lower costs. Due to proactive issue resolution, you’ll spend less compared to fixing issues when they already disrupt the user experience and your processes. When maintenance efforts are incorporated on time, you can effectively manage your app and not let any issues affect how it’s perceived by users. With consistent and continuous maintenance, your app will stay up-to-date with user demands and industry trends, be more resilient to security threats, and be easy to scale or change at any given moment.
-
When do I need to start application maintenance?
The optimal time to start with maintenance services is during the final stages of development. This will allow for a seamless transition from development to production support. Regardless of the size of your company, be it a startup or an enterprise, app maintenance should begin immediately after deployment. For web app maintenance services, we recommend starting maintenance before the application experiences significant user growth. For mobile application support services, you should begin with support and maintenance as soon as the product is published to app stores, as mobile platforms frequently update their requirements and standards.
-
How much does app maintenance cost?
You can budget your application’s maintenance according to the overall development cost. It usually takes around 10-20% of the development cost per year. However, every situation is unique and there are a number of factors influencing the cost: app complexity, frequency of updates, the amount of data involved, user traffic volumes, third-party integrations, legal constraints, and so on. For example, a relatively simple app can cost around $500 per month to maintain (including bug fixes and updates), while a complex platform that relies on third-party integrations and should comply with specific regulations can extend the maintenance monthly budget to $3,000-5,000. The cost also depends on your goals and current agenda: major updates or changes to the functionality will require a bigger investment. If you want to get a more specific estimate on your app maintenance, drop us a line. We’ll get back to you to discuss your application and suggest a possible maintenance strategy and plan.
-
Does it make sense to outsource application support?
The short answer is yes. If you don’t have an internal team or it’s hard to allocate the required resources, outsourcing application support is your best choice. It’s cheaper than hiring additional professionals internally, there are different options of cooperation, and you’ll have access to a wide range of domain and tech expertise.
-
How to find an app maintenance company?
To find a reliable provider to handle your app’s maintenance and improvement, search for companies on platforms like Clutch. There, you can browse through the portfolios of providers and read reviews. Find a company that has already worked with similar projects and then schedule an introductory call to learn about the models of cooperation, communication tools, budget options, and other details.
-
How do I prepare an app for the maintenance stage?
Essentially, you’ll need to gather technical documentation and familiarize the provider with your business context. If there’s not enough documentation, you should prioritize updating it before handing over your app to the maintenance team. It’s also important to provide information on previous support and maintenance efforts if the app was already released and offer the history of known issues. Last but not least, you’ll have to prepare all necessary access credentials so that the support and maintenance team can access all the required tools. If you don’t have an internal tech team to handle these processes, we can guide you through all the necessary steps to prepare your application for the handout. Reach out to us to learn more details.

